“One for Sorrow” is an original mixed media painting by the artist Michael Tierney based on the old folklore rhyme of the same title. The rhyme, originally used for counting magpies in some regions and crows in others has always intrigued the artist since childhood. There are many variations and interpretations of the wording but the underlying tones of superstition, birth, death, sex and religion are undeniable. The painting captures these themes in a wild collision of styles and colour. One for sorrow Two for joy Three for a girl Four for a boy Five for silver Six for gold Seven for a secret never to be told Eight for heaven Nine for hell Ten for the devil’s own sel’ The painting comes ready to hang with deep painted. Michael Tierney’s paintings are a celebration of the diverse and multi-layered aspects of contemporary culture that surround and sometimes overwhelm us. His imagery is inspired by everything from travel, nature, science, history, politics and religion to video games, pop culture and fashion. The artist’s work is included in numerous collections across the world. He has exhibited and sold both nationally and internationally and he has been featured in many newspapers and magazines. In 2016 his work was selected as Image of the Week in The Guardian newspaper where his work was published alongside other International artists including Antony Gormley, Wolfgang Tillmans, Michael Craig Martin, Rankin and Eva Rothschild as part of the Stronger In Europe poster campaign. His work has been published on both The Royal Academy’s website, and Dazed.com. The Wall Street Journal named him as “a rising star”. Michael lives and works in St Leonards on Sea, East Sussex.
